ˈfɔ:məl adj. & n. --adj. 1 used or
done or
held in
accordance with rules,
convention, or
ceremony (formal
dress; a formal occasion). 2
ceremonial; required by convention (a formal call). 3
precise or symmetrical (a formal garden). 4
prim or
stiff in
manner. 5
perfunctory, having
the form without the
spirit. 6
valid or correctly so called
because of
its form;
explicit and definite (a formal agreement). 7 in accordance with recognized forms or rules. 8 of or
concerned with (outward) form or
appearance,
esp. as
distinct from content or
matter. 9
Logic concerned with the form and
not the matter of reasoning. 10 Philos. of the
essence of a
thing;
essential not
material. --n. US 1
evening dress. 2 an
occasion on
which evening dress is
worn. øøformally adv. formalness n. [ME f. L formalis (as FORM)]
